TRAINING UPDATE
The Committee is looking to get all clerks up to speed on basic Webmastering duties, especially posting and editing content. Kerri created three initial screencasts -- like a video capture of a computer screen accompanied by audio -- and sent them to the town and village clerks for trial. Joan and Gail reported that they were able to view the screencast tutorials and that they were helpful in learning how to administer the site.
Regarding who should receive training and have access as administrators, the Committee agreed that both town and village governments need to commit more resources to handle the ongoing work required with maintaining the site. For the town, Bruce suggested that we outline a part-time Web master position including duties and hourly rate for consideration in the upcoming budget talks. Kevin indicated that the village an assistant clerk position is already in the works, and that we might want to think about having the assistant clerk assist with the Web site.
Though we discussed the possibility of training committee and department heads having access to their own pages, we recommend that the majority of updating be centralized through a town and/or village Webmaster or clerk position. This will limit the number of people who have to be trained and ensure more consistent presentation of the content. However, the committee also agree that if there is a department representative who is interested and capable of updating their respective department page, we should consider the possibility of adding that person as an administrator.
Bruce and Kevin both suggested that we two levels of training -- one for the administrators which would be more technical in nature, and a second training for departments which would be more procedural -- what can you post on the site, how do things get posted, who posts, etc.

NAVIGATION IMPROVEMENTS
In response to our July discussion on streamlining and improving the home page and site navigation, Kerri presented a draft version of new navigation -- essentially reorganized for easier access. Kathy reiterated her suggestion for a home page welcome vs. the current model where the user immediately jumps into the news stream. With a few tweaks the committee agreed on reorganized navigation.
A new section -- Forms & Applications -- was suggested. Bruce and Kevin said that they would gather their respective municipality's forms so that they could be posted on the Web site in this new section.
